Output 1426c24e993f6f0f0fe2bc38fb32781a50012b8de41694cd3260437bb3383f90: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eaf4bcaa57dc8cdec6a4eb244637c217c9574ec OP_EQUAL
address
37QTpDmxK4EMd2PhFZEBL1Q1AyS5Ycyp3N
transaction
1426c24e993f6f0f0fe2bc38fb32781a50012b8de41694cd3260437bb3383f90
confirmations
284062
spent
true